On The Villainess Aug 16, 2018
Title The Villainess Spoiler
It’s really bothering me. A lot of the main characters didn’t make sense. The first husband: he claims at the end of the movie that when she died he was in pain. So when he found out she was alive he should’ve taken it as a second chance to amend things. Or he should’ve shot her the moment he found out it was her if he wanted her dead so badly because having everyone she is involved with killed - including himself - really doesn’t make sense. He doesn’t win anything.

Secondly, the boss Kwon Sook: She claims to have given her advice and tried to warn her. And she also told the second husband that she didn’t want him to end up in a mess. If she didn’t want a mess she should’ve had someone else sniper the first husband. Then he would be dead and nothing would’ve happened. OR she could’ve explained the truth about the first husband to Sook Hee and prevented all of the shit that went down in the second half of the movie. Losing your best operative isn’t a winning move either.

Otherwise, if i don’t think too much, I loved the movie. Sung Joon was swoon worthy in this movie.
